The highly anticipated wedding of Indian cricketer Smriti Mandhana has been postponed due to the sudden hospitalization of her father, Shrinivas Mandhana, who experienced heart-attack-like symptoms. Adding to the family’s distress, groom-to-be Palash Muchhal, a music composer, was also hospitalized due to emotional stress triggered by Shrinivas’s condition.
According to reports, Palash is deeply attached to Smriti’s father, and the news of his illness profoundly affected him. Palash’s mother, Amita Muchhal, revealed that he insisted on postponing the wedding until Shrinivas recovered, a decision made even before Smriti could react. Doctors suspect the elder Mandhana’s condition was brought on by the intense physical and mental stress associated with the wedding preparations.
The wedding was scheduled to take place in Sangli. Only the final rituals remained when the family made the difficult decision to postpone the event. Amita Muchhal expressed the disappointment of both Smriti and Palash, emphasizing that her son had eagerly anticipated bringing his bride home. Despite the setback, she remains optimistic, assuring everyone that the wedding will be rescheduled as soon as possible and that Shrinivas’s health is the priority.
The family is currently focused on supporting Shrinivas and Palash’s recovery, hoping for a swift return to health for both.
